## Auth

Heads up: the cutoff engine for CrumbWorks decides at 14:00 local whether tomorrow's custom cake orders are locked. If you're on call and need to poke the cutoff API directly, you'll need the internal service credential — don't reuse your personal token, it lacks the override scope. The key you want is right here.

gateway credential: kto23_LX9A4ys6i4nzHtpOLNLodKK

For the weekly sync: the Matchwell matching service is still seeing 300–600ms GC pauses during peak pairing windows, which trips the upstream timeout. This release switches the service to the tuned collector profile and halves the live-set by moving candidate caches off-heap. Rollout is canary-first, one region per hour, with pause-time dashboards as the gate. Canary promotion is a signed operation; whoever runs it needs the release signing key loaded into their promotion tool. The current key is given here.

release key, yagap-kagag: bky6_1ks93y

Ticket: Dark-mode styles missing in Opaline admin dashboard staging. Root cause: staging pods were built with THEME_MODE unset, so the theming service fell back to light-only bundles. For the weekly sync: fix requires regenerating the staging env file from the current template, which now includes the theming service credential. Redeploy after the env file gains that credential line.

secret setting of hawep-yahig: LEDGER_TOKEN29=41b5d6315371c92885eaeb077fb63

Subject: Kestwick Partners Term Sheet — Summary for Branch Managers

Team,

We received the revised term sheet from Kestwick Partners yesterday. Headline terms: co-branded distribution across their Northfield network, three-year exclusivity in that region, and shared marketing costs at a 60/40 split in our favour. Legal is reviewing termination clauses; Finance is modelling volume commitments. Nothing is signed, so keep this off branch floors. We expect a decision within three weeks. The confidential planning note follows below:

— Marta

board note of bawep-tajef: Queniusek Systems plans to raise the Quenvan list price by 53.1 percent in March. The pricing group signed off on a budget of $176.4 million for Project Drueth. The renewal with Casionix Partners closes at $142.5 million a year, 8.3 percent below the last contract. Project Fraax slips by six weeks because of the tooling delay.